Comprehending Private Mental Health Diagnosis
Private mental health diagnosis describes the procedure of assessing mental health conditions by qualified professionals in a private practice setting. This can consist of psychologists, psychiatrists, scientific social employees, and accredited counselors. Such services frequently guarantee a greater level of privacy and individualized care than might be found in public health care systems.
Why Consider a Private Diagnosis?
There are various reasons why individuals may select to pursue a private mental health diagnosis:
Reduced Wait Times: Public healthcare systems typically have long waiting lists, especially for expert assessments. Private services provide quicker access to necessary examinations.
Individualized Attention: In a private setting, individuals may experience more individually time with their professionals, enabling a more tailored technique to their mental health issues.
Confidentiality and Comfort: Those who look for a private diagnosis might feel more comfy going over delicate problems with somebody in a private practice, minimizing potential preconception connected with mental healthcare.
Thorough Assessments: Many private specialists offer holistic assessments that include a complete examination of mental, physical, and social aspects contributing to the patient's condition.
How to Find Private Mental Health Diagnosis Services Near You
Finding private mental health services can feel challenging, however various resources can assist streamline the process. Here's a step-by-step guide to locating these companies:
Step-by-Step Guide
Online Research: Start by conducting online searches using terms like "private mental health diagnosis near me mental health diagnostic services near me" or "psychologists in [your location]" Websites such as Psychology Today permit you to filter based on specializeds and locations.
Seek Advice From Medical Professionals: Speak with your main care doctor or any other relied on physician. They can frequently offer recommendations to trustworthy mental health specialists.
Inspect Credentials: Once you have a list of potential companies, check their qualifications through local licensing boards to ensure they are certified and have clean disciplinary records.
Check out Reviews: Online evaluations on platforms like Yelp or Google can offer insight into the experiences of previous clients. Nevertheless, remember that experiences can vary commonly.
Insurance coverage Coverage: If you have medical insurance, refer to your strategy to see if it covers any private mental health services. Some professionals may use sliding scale fees for those without insurance.
Schedule Consultations: Many specialists provide initial consultations. Use this chance to assess whether their method resonates with you.

Q1: How much does a private mental health diagnosis cost?
The cost of private mental health diagnostics differs extensively based on the provider, location, and specific services offered. Typically, initial examinations can vary from ₤ 100 to ₤ 500, while continuous sessions might range from ₤ 75 to ₤ 250.
Q2: How long does it require to get a diagnosis?
The time required for a diagnosis can vary based on the intricacy of the case and the supplier's technique. Some evaluations may take one session, while others might need numerous consultations over several weeks.
Q3: Do I need a referral for a private mental health diagnosis?
In many cases, you do not need a recommendation to look for care from a private mental health service provider. However, talk to your medical insurance strategy if you mean to use insurance to cover expenses.
Q4: What should I expect during my very first appointment?
Your first visit usually includes a consumption assessment, where the company will ask concerns about your mental and physical health history, present symptoms, and any previous treatments.
